MPJ Recruitment are proud to be working with one of the leading providers of repair services in the North West. We aim to provide an efficient and transparent customer experience for all clients throughout their journey regardless of complexity or challenge.

As a rapidly growing business we are now expanding our team and are looking to recruit an experienced Repair Supply Handler to join the department based in our Central Manchester office.

Customer Service Advisor duties:

  • Review claims in accordance with vehicle repair progression to help manage repair times and ensure unnecessary delays are minimised.
  • Ensure key data is populated into the relevant fields within the CMS.
  • Liaise consistently with various suppliers throughout the repair related supply chain, namely but not limited to, repairers, engineers, roadside recovery agents, and salvage agents in order to guarantee a smooth process and ensure SLAs are adhered to.
  • Create and maintain effective professional relationships with referrers and supply partners negotiating confidently and finding mutually agreeable solutions when required.
  • Ensure all tasks and communications are diarised and followed up to conclusion.
  • Act with integrity and professionalism, maintaining company values and standards at all times.
  • Ensure that adherence to all company policies are followed which range from DPA, treating customers fairly, GDPR and FCA regulations.
  • Undertake any duties reasonably necessary as directed by your line manager.
  • Be proficient with MS Excel
  • Have excellent communication skills (both written and verbal) with a high level of attention to detail.
  • To collaborate with internal stakeholders of all levels where required and work cohesively together to achieve the Company goals.
  • Be able to maintain high standards of work when under pressure and within deadlines.
  • Keep up to date with all legislation and regulatory changes.
  • Accustomed to a target driven environment preferred
  • Excellent planning, organisational and time management skills with the ability to be proactive in the management of their duties is a key component to success in this role
  • Previous administration experience advantageous
